Nature & Stories at the Plainsboro Preserve

A free, engaging storytime event for children at the preserve.

Thu, 18 Jun 2026 10:30 AM – 11:30 AM (EDT) Plainsboro Preserve Cranbury , New Jersey
Bring your little ones to the Plainsboro Preserve for an enchanting morning of Nature & Stories. This free event, hosted in collaboration with the Plainsboro Public Library, invites children to explore the wonders of the natural world through captivating tales. It is a perfect opportunity for families to enjoy the outdoors while fostering a love for reading and nature. Join our staff for a delightful hour of storytelling in a beautiful, serene setting.
